Rhythm & Harmony bested 13 other performers to win the grand prize of the 2014 CNMI Got Talent held last Dec. 19 at the Pacific Islands Club Saipan Magellan. The MHS Glee Club also won Best Team and the Governor’s Choice Award.
Saipan Community School 5th grade student Kevin Liang wowed the audience with his talent playing the violin, which was enough to win him the Second Mini Grand Prize.
D.J. Santino proved that big things come in small packages with his rendition of Mariah Carey’s All I Want for Christmas Is You. He won the second runner-up prize.
The Glushko Ballerinas—Cerinn Hwang, Fay Sizemore, Annabelle Sablan, and Sakura Imaya—once again brought grace in this year’s CNMI Got Talent competition, which was enough to give them the third runner-up prize.
Abby Racoma made everyone in attendance smile with the pop music she was able to strum out of her ukulele. Emcee Jojo Camacho interviews her here after her number.
